Abstract

This review paper summarizes the importance of thermal management system and mathematical models used in the prediction of temperature distribution of an induction motor. The lumped parameter thermal network modelling approach is explained in detail with a suitable example. The recent computational methods and their pros and cons on estimating the temperature distribution are discussed. The experimental method on estimating equivalent value for thermal resistance and capacitance is highlighted from the literature. The understanding on physical mechanism of heat transfer is emphasized to recognize thermal flow path for better utilization of cooling techniques. The recent trend in coupling electromagnetic and thermal phenomena is also considered. This study will be helpful on future design of induction motor to meet difficult constraints.
